Copy 752 of 999 of the bibliophile book made up of a copper case and a cardboard case lined with black cloth, containing an engraving, 23 diptychs and 6 triptychs of handcrafted paper accompanied by six copper transparencies. Copper case dimensions: ??38.9 x 28.3 x 6.9 cm. . Dimensions of the cardboard case lined with black fabric: 38.5 x 28 x 6.4 cm. . Format of the engraving sheet, diptychs and triptychs: 25.5 x 35 cm. . Format of the copper transparencies: ??22.5 x 32 cm. . Diptychs and triptychs: texts stamped with metallic magnesium engravings on 120 gr craft paper, made from virgin cotton and eucalyptus fibers. DESCRIPTION OF THE EDITIONS Two editions have been made of this Artwork: Deluxe Edition. 999 copies numbered from 1/999 to 999/999. . Numbered copper box with the laser-engraved signature of Jaume Plensa. . Chalcographic engraving, based on a drawing by Jaume Plensa, on 300-gram artisan paper, made from virgin cotton and eucalyptus fibers, at the Ca l'Oliver paper mill. Collector's Edition. 75 copies numbered from 1/75 to 75/75, signed by Jaume Plensa. . Copper case numbered and signed by hand by Jaume Plensa. . Chalcographic engraving on handmade paper, with cotton fiber, at the Museo Molino Papelero de Capellades, signed and numbered by Jaume Plensa from 1/75 to 75/75.
